NOISZ is a vertical hybrid between shoot-em-up, rhythm and visual novel genres developed by Anarch Entertainment in 2018 for Windows and Mac. It plays like a boss rush game, with individual battles timed to the music featuring as stages, bridged by story sections. It has plenty of accesibility on its difficulty for first-time bullet hell players, as well as unmerciful challenges for skilled wizards.
The base game is considered NOISZ Ignition, and it also has a DLC called NOISZ re:||VERSE which released on 2020.

Gameplay Overview
NOISZ is a three-button game where the player is controllable around a 2D axis on any direction and they get to fight bosses on an average length of 3 to 4 minutes per battle. Both the player and the boss are timed to the song playing during the battle, and must attack following the beats; as thus, battles are usually referenced as "songs" for the sake of simplicity.
The game currently has 4 difficulties per song: Easy, Normal, Hard and Overload.
There are up to 7 possible styles to use, and those are further modified by any of the 7 modules available, which brings the total to 49 possible shot types to use. There are also special, song-unique styles.
Controls
The game defaults to keyboard and an usual set of keys for its gameplay with no option to change ingame, although those are editable on its Local AppData folder.
Note that the keys do not have any hold function outside of exiting to menus; the game must be played by pressing. There also is no pause button.
- Z: Shoot
- X: Shield
- C: Special
- Enter: Select (menus)
- Esc (hold): Leave menu/battle
